Witryna2 sie 2014 · The MG 08 was the standard German machine gun. A copy of Hiram Maxim's design from 1894, it was a clumsy weapon by modern standards. Witryna2 sie 2024 · Calibre: 8mm. Weight: 55lbs plus 60 lbs tripod. Rate of Fire: 600 RPM. The Hotchkiss replaced the less reliable Saint-Etienne machine gun in the French infantry in 1916. Although it was very heavy at 115lbs altogether, it became far and away the most popular machine gun in the French forces, and found use in anti-balloon fighting.
